LONDON, June 05,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Enko Capital ('Enko'), an African-focused asset management firm managing debt, private debt, equity and private equity investments across Africa, has welcomed commitment from International Finance Corporation ('IFC') to its new Impact Credit Fund ('EICF').
The commitment has been confirmed by IFC with the planned equity investment in the fund being up to the lower of US$25 million or 20% of total Limited Partner (LP) commitment to EICF. The project is being processed under IFC's Debt Funds Project (DFP) Investment Framework.
EICF is Enko's first private credit vehicle. It has a target LP commitment size of US$150 million, targeting US$80 million at first close, expected to take place in Q3 2025. EICF's objective is to invest in a diversified portfolio of USD denominated senior secured and unsecured debt to mid-sized corporates in sub-Saharan Africa, excluding South Africa.
EICF will seek to invest in SDG-aligned, ESG focused and gender-oriented businesses, while generating commercial returns and utilising guarantees, insurance wraps and collateral to hedge downside credit risks.
Alain Nkontchou, Managing Partner of Enko, said, 'We are delighted to have received this invaluable support from IFC for our debut private credit fund. The fund will provide critical growth capital for mid-market SMEs on the continent and will deliver both positive social impact and compelling risk-adjusted returns. This growth capital can help address the massive funding gap which businesses on the continent face while driving sustainable development.'
About Enko:
Enko Capital ('Enko'), is an African-focused asset management firm managing debt, private debt, equity and private equity investments across Africa. Enko offers deep knowledge of the continent combined with best-in-class investment expertise. Enko was founded in 2008 by Alain and Cyrille Nkontchou, and has over $1bn in assets under management.

The combined company will create a leading ambulatory infusion platform with more than 75 outpatient locations across 14 states throughout the U.S. PHOENIX & TAYLORSVILLE, Utah, August 13, 2025--(BUSINESS WIRE)--AleraCare, a leading provider of infusion and specialty pharmacy services across the U.S., and PURE Healthcare, a leading national medical group that delivers healthcare services for individuals with complex chronic con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is, Crohn's disease, multiple sclerosis, Alzheimer's disease and other autoimmune conditions, today announced that the businesses have entered into a definitive merger agreement. Terms of the transaction were not disclosed. The proposed merger creates an unprecedented opportunity to provide high-quality patient care, improve clinical outcomes and enhance the availability of infusion services that lower the overall cost to the healthcare system overall. Founded in 2019, AleraCare's core lines of business include ambulatory infusion centers, home infusion therapy and specialty pharmacy. Administered at convenient, accessible, patient-first locations, AleraCare is focused on maintaining trusted-partner status with physicians, payors, drug distributors and pharmaceutical manufacturers. The company has rapidly expanded to over 30 ambulatory infusion centers across the country and is a provider-of-choice for infusion services to high-need and medically complex populations. Pure Healthcare, founded in 2018, is on a mission to transform the healthcare industry by making infusion therapy more affordable and accessible—while delivering a personalized, patient-centered experience. Pure specializes in treating chronic and autoimmune conditions such as Alzheimer's disease, multiple sclerosis, and rheumatoid arthritis, offering innovative, high-quality care tailored to individual needs. Its flagship offering, Pure Infusion Suites, has expanded to 43 locations across 14 states. These state-of-the-art suites prioritize patient comfort with private rooms, snacks, and entertainment, all while significantly lowering the cost of infusion services. Pure Healthcare also alleviates the administrative burden for referring providers by supporting patient authorizations and fostering strong partnerships with insurers, ensuring a seamless and efficient care journey from referral to treatment. The transaction is expected to close in the fourth quarter of 2025, and remains subject to customary closing conditions, including the expiration or termination of the applicable waiting period under the Hart-Scott-Rodino Antitrust Improvements Act of 1976. Holland & Knight is serving as legal counsel for AleraCare. Kunzler Bean & Adamson is serving as legal counsel and Cantor Fitzgerald is acting as financial advisor for PURE Healthcare. About AleraCare AleraCare is a leading provider of infusion treatments and pharmacy services for high-need and medically complex populations. The company's core lines of business include ambulatory infusion centers, home infusion therapy and specialty pharmacy. AleraCare provides care to patients in over 30 locations across six states throughout the U.S., including Arizona, California, Colorado, Idaho, New Mexico and Utah. Key Takeaways U.S. equities edged higher at midday, with the S&P 500 and Nasdaq adding to their record closes, on optimism the Federal Reserve will lower interest rates next month. The hope of falling borrowing costs lifted shares of Lennar and rival home builders. CAVA Group's same-store sales came in well below expectations, sending shares of the Mediterranean-themed restaurant lower.U.S. equities edged higher at midday on continuing optimism the latest consumer inflation data will open the door to the Federal Reserve to cut interest rates next month. The S&P 500 and Nasdaq added to their record closes yesterday, and the Dow Jones Industrial Average was higher as well. Speculation that the Fed may make a large reduction in borrowing costs sent the 10-year Treasury yield lower and lifted shares of home builders Lennar (LEN), D.H. Horton (DHI), and PulteGroup (PHM). Shares of Gildan Activewear (GIL) jumped when the T-shirt manufacturer agreed to purchase undergarment maker Hanesbrands (HBI) for $2.2 billion, less than what was reported earlier. Hanesbrands shares gained as well. V2X (VVX) shares advanced on an upgrade from Bank of America, which said it was optimistic about the defense contractor's growth. CAVA Group (CAVA) shares tumbled when the Mediterranean-themed restaurant chain reported weaker-than-anticipated same-restaurant sales and reduced its guidance as consumers pulled back spending at its locations. Shares of CoreWeave (CRWV) tumbled after the provider of artificial intelligence computing posted a much larger-than-expected loss as expenses soared, and it warned it would continue to face higher costs to keep up with demand for its products. Circle Internet Group (CRCL) shares slid when the distributor of the USDC stablecoin announced a sale of 10 million Class A shares that includes 2 million from the company and 8 million from investors. Oil futures declined. Gold prices rose. The U.S. dollar lost ground to the euro, pound, and yen. Major cryptocurrencies were mixed.
